Logan
One of the newest and the hardest hitting, Logan was a superhero movie beyond compare. Sure, it lacked the high-flying moves and laser wars like other superhero movies, but it was one that had a lot of substance. Logan also brings us a career defining movie for Hugh Jackman who has played the role of Wolverine for almost a decade now. His appearance as an older Logan is not just realistic but it also brings us to the future of X-Men. The storytelling is so beautiful that you feel helpless, nostalgic and empowered, all at the same time.
The Dark Knight Trilogy
If I used each of the movies in this list separately, it would be a crime. The Batman trilogy featuring Christian Bale as a serious and brooding Batman comes with some of the most interesting and befitting portrayals of the superhero. It’s about as close to a realistic adaptation of Batman as one can get. Granted, it helps that a character like batman has a lot of money to spend, which means even in the real world, he could afford to be a superhero. But that’s only used as a backdrop in the Dark Knight movies to talk about larger themes of class discrimination, morality, and the nature of vigilantism. The direction of Christopher Nolan and the work by the entire cast is so good and exceptionally high-rated, that you cannot watch one movie. This is one of the most amazing Batman films out there- in the form of a trilogy that you will love forever.
Spider-Man 2
This is one of the best superhero movies of all times and most fans will agree. Spider-Man 2 consisted of Toby Maguire’s best ever portrayal of the superhero on screen. Though I love the current Spidey franchise too, there was something about Toby’s vulnerable, love-struck and newly powerful portrayal of Peter Parker that always clicks with me. Dr. Octopus brings back one of the most formidable enemies he has ever had and the movie is amazing in all aspects.
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se
It really doesn’t need to be said that the web-slinger is not only one of the most popular comic book characters, but he’s also one of the most popular cartoon characters in history, and his animated legacy is lifted higher with this latest outing. With groundbreaking animation, a fresh concept, and the long-awaited introduction of Miles Morales as Spider-Man, Into the Spider-Verse is not only one of the best superhero movies, but it might also be one of the best animated films in recent memory.
